Understanding Floodplain Dynamics through Geospatial Analysis
One of the primary applications of EDPs in Geospatial Floodplain Analysis and Visualization is to enhance understanding of floodplain dynamics. By leveraging geospatial technologies such as GIS, remote sensing, and spatial modeling, professionals can analyze floodplain characteristics, including topography, soil type, and land use patterns. This information is critical in identifying areas of high flood risk, predicting flood behavior, and developing effective flood mitigation strategies. For instance, a case study in the Netherlands demonstrated how geospatial analysis was used to identify flood-prone areas and develop targeted flood protection measures, resulting in significant reductions in flood risk and damage.
Visualization and Communication: Key to Effective Floodplain Management
Effective communication and visualization of floodplain data are essential for stakeholder engagement, decision-making, and policy development. EDPs in Geospatial Floodplain Analysis and Visualization emphasize the importance of visualization techniques, such as 3D modeling and virtual reality, in conveying complex floodplain information to diverse audiences. A real-world example of this is the use of interactive flood maps in the city of Brisbane, Australia, which enabled residents to visualize flood risk and make informed decisions about property development and flood insurance. By facilitating stakeholder engagement and participation, visualization and communication play a vital role in building resilient and adaptable floodplain management systems.
